A delicate, signature-like script with a pronounced rightward slant and long, sweeping entry and exit strokes. The letterforms are built from thin, smooth strokes with subtle thick–thin modulation, giving a lightly calligraphic feel without heavy pen pressure. Capitals are tall and expressive with generous loops and occasional cross-strokes that extend well beyond the letter body, while lowercase forms are compact with a notably small x-height and elongated ascenders/descenders. Spacing and widths vary in a natural handwritten rhythm, and many characters connect fluidly, producing continuous cursive word shapes.

Best suited to display settings where its thin strokes and flourishes can be appreciated—such as wedding suites, invitations, beauty or boutique branding, logo wordmarks, and premium packaging accents. It also works well for short quotes or headings, especially with generous spacing and ample size.

The overall tone is graceful and intimate, evoking handwritten notes, invitations, and personal signatures. Its light touch and looping swashes read as romantic and refined rather than casual or playful, with a fashion-forward polish in longer words and headlines.

The design appears intended to mimic a polished, modern handwritten signature with calligraphic flair—prioritizing fluid connections, tall elegant capitals, and graceful movement across the baseline to create a luxurious, personal impression.

The most distinctive visual features are the tall, flourished capitals and the long horizontal strokes on letters like T and F, which can create dramatic word silhouettes. Numerals follow the same thin, cursive construction, matching the script’s light, elegant rhythm.
